Holiday Inn Express Durham an IHG Hotel is happy to welcome your pets with open arms. You may bring up to 2 pets, weighing up to 50 lbs. per pet. A pet fee of $75 per stay is collected by the property upon arrival and provides for additional cleaning and amenities. Cats are welcomed, and there are convenient pet relief areas nearby. Located just off Interstate 85, this hotel is 3 miles from Duke University. It serves a continental breakfast every morning and features an outdoor pool and a concierge service. Free Wi-Fi access and cable TV are included in every room at Holiday Inn Express Durham. They are equipped with a microwave, a refrigerator, and a coffee maker. The front desk at the Durham Holiday Inn Express is staffed 24 hours a day. The hotel also offers a business center and a free shuttle to the Duke University Medical Center. The Northgate Mall is 0.9 miles from the hotel. The Museum of Life & Science is a 5-minute drive away.
